Residential propane piping services involve installing, repairing, and maintaining the network of pipes that deliver propane gas safely throughout a home. These services ensure that propane is supplied efficiently to appliances such as furnaces, water heaters, stoves, and fireplaces. Proper installation and upkeep of propane piping help prevent leaks, blockages, and other issues that could disrupt gas flow or compromise safety. Skilled contractors focus on ensuring the piping system meets safety standards and functions reliably, providing homeowners with peace of mind when using propane for heating and cooking needs.
Problems with propane piping can include leaks, corrosion, or damage caused by shifting soil, tree roots, or aging materials. Such issues may lead to gas odors, decreased appliance performance, or, in severe cases, safety hazards. Regular inspections and timely repairs can help identify potential problems before they become serious, avoiding costly repairs or dangerous situations. If a home experiences inconsistent heating, a noticeable smell of gas, or has recently undergone renovations that involved moving appliances or walls, it may be time to consult a professional for propane piping assessments and repairs.
Propane piping services are commonly used in a variety of property types, including single-family homes, multi-unit residences, and rural properties. Homes that rely on propane for heating, cooking, or water heating often have dedicated piping systems installed or upgraded by local contractors. Rural properties without access to natural gas pipelines frequently depend on propane, making proper piping essential for safe and reliable service. The overview below groups typical Residential Propane Piping proj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Irving,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or propane piping repairs or adjustments usually range from $150 to $400.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the complexity and accessibility of the piping system.
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of residential propane piping generally costs between $600 and $1,500. Larger, more involved projects tend to push into higher price ranges but are less common for standard homes.
Full System Installation - Installing a complete propane piping system in a home can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more. These larger projects are less frequent but are necessary for new construction or major upgrades.
Complex or Custom Projects - Highly complex or custom propane piping jobs, such as extensive rerouting or integrating with other systems, can exceed $5,000. Such projects are relatively rare and typically involve specialized requ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are residential propane piping services? Residential propane piping services involve installing, repairing, or replacing the piping system that delivers propane gas to appliances in a home, ensuring safe and efficient operation.
Why should I hire a professional for propane piping installation? A professional contractor ensures proper installation according to safety standards, reduces the risk of leaks or hazards, and helps maintain the integrity of the propane system in a home.
How can I tell if my propane piping needs repairs? Signs of potential issues include the smell of gas, hissing sounds near the piping, or visible damage or corrosion on the pipes, which should be inspected by a qualified service provider.
What types of propane piping materials are commonly used in homes? Common materials include steel, copper, and flexible stainless steel connectors, chosen based on the home’s needs and local safety codes.
How do local contractors ensure the safety of propane piping systems? They follow established installation and maintenance practices, conduct thorough inspections, and adhere to safety guidelines to help minimize risks associated with propane gas in residential settings.
